Devdutt Padikkal scores maiden Test century in Galle against Sri Lanka
Yahoo Sports • 1 min read • Latest: Aug 16, 2026, 4:27 AM
Last updated Aug 16, 2026

Devdutt Padikkal scored his first Test century while battling heat and fatigue on Day 1 in Galle against Sri Lanka. His innings, marked by a 150-run partnership with KL Rahul, helped anchor India's first innings while Rahul later retired hurt on 77 due to cramps. Padikkal's performance likely secures his position at No. 3 after a nearly two-year absence from the Test side. Reflecting on his innings, Padikkal noted the challenges posed by the conditions but expressed satisfaction with overcoming them to achieve the milestone.
